Defining Low Hemoglobin: Numbers and Nuances

The term “low hemoglobin” isn’t a one-size-fits-all designation. What’s considered low can vary slightly depending on factors such as age, sex, and even the laboratory performing the test. However, general guidelines are established by medical professionals.

Understanding Hemoglobin Levels: The Numbers Game

Hemoglobin levels are typically measured in grams per deciliter (g/dL). According to the World Health Organization (WHO) and many national health organizations, the following are generally accepted ranges for non-pregnant adults:

  • Men: A normal hemoglobin level is typically between 13.5 and 17.5 g/dL. Levels below 13.5 g/dL are considered low.
  • Women: A normal hemoglobin level is typically between 12.0 and 15.5 g/dL. Levels below 12.0 g/dL are considered low.
  • Pregnant Women: Hemoglobin levels naturally decrease during pregnancy due to an increase in blood volume. For pregnant women, a level below 11.0 g/dL is generally considered low.
  • Children: Normal ranges vary significantly with age. For infants, levels are higher at birth and gradually decrease. For older children, ranges become closer to adult levels, with specific values depending on their age and developmental stage.

It’s crucial to remember that these are general guidelines. A single low reading doesn’t automatically mean you have a serious medical condition. Your doctor will consider your individual health history, other symptoms, and potentially repeat the test to confirm a diagnosis.

Beyond the Numbers: The Impact of Low Hemoglobin

While the numerical value of your hemoglobin is important for diagnosis, it’s the consequences of low hemoglobin that truly highlight why it matters. The primary function of hemoglobin is to carry oxygen. When hemoglobin levels are insufficient, your body’s tissues and organs don’t receive enough oxygen to function optimally. This can manifest in a wide range of symptoms, affecting your physical and even cognitive well-being.

Common symptoms of low hemoglobin include:

  • Fatigue and Weakness: This is often the most prominent symptom. You might feel constantly tired, lacking energy, and experiencing muscle weakness. Simple daily tasks can feel exhausting.
  • Pale Skin: Reduced hemoglobin can lead to a paleness in the skin, particularly noticeable on the face, inside the lips, and under the eyelids.
  • Shortness of Breath: Your body tries to compensate for low oxygen by breathing faster and deeper. This can result in feeling breathless, especially during exertion.
  • Headaches and Dizziness: Insufficient oxygen to the brain can cause frequent headaches and feelings of lightheadedness or dizziness.
  • Cold Hands and Feet: Poor circulation due to reduced oxygen transport can lead to extremities feeling cold.
  • Brittle Nails and Hair Loss: Over time, chronic low hemoglobin can affect the health of your nails and hair.
  • Rapid or Irregular Heartbeat: The heart may beat faster to try and circulate oxygenated blood more efficiently.
  • Chest Pain: In severe cases, the heart may struggle to get enough oxygen, leading to chest pain.

The severity of these symptoms generally correlates with how low the hemoglobin level is and how quickly it has dropped. A gradual decline might lead to milder, more insidious symptoms, while a rapid drop can cause more acute and noticeable distress.

Causes of Low Hemoglobin: Unraveling the “Why”

Low hemoglobin, medically known as anemia, is not a disease in itself but rather a symptom of an underlying issue. Identifying the root cause is paramount for effective treatment. The reasons for low hemoglobin are diverse and can be broadly categorized into three main groups: decreased red blood cell production, increased red blood cell destruction, and blood loss.

Decreased Red Blood Cell Production: The Factory Slowdown

Red blood cells are produced in the bone marrow, a spongy tissue found inside your bones. Several factors can impair this production process:

  • Nutritional Deficiencies: This is one of the most common causes of anemia.
    • Iron Deficiency: Iron is a critical component of hemoglobin. Insufficient dietary iron intake, poor iron absorption, or increased iron needs (like during pregnancy) can lead to iron-deficiency anemia.
    • Vitamin B12 Deficiency: Vitamin B12 is essential for red blood cell formation. Conditions like pernicious anemia (an autoimmune disorder affecting B12 absorption), strict vegetarian or vegan diets without proper supplementation, or certain gastrointestinal surgeries can lead to B12 deficiency.
    • Folate (Folic Acid) Deficiency: Folate, another B vitamin, is also vital for DNA synthesis and red blood cell production. Poor diet, malabsorption issues, or increased needs can cause folate deficiency.
  • Bone Marrow Problems: The bone marrow itself can be affected by various conditions:
    • Aplastic Anemia: A rare condition where the bone marrow doesn’t produce enough blood cells.
    • Leukemia and Lymphoma: Cancers of the blood and lymph system can infiltrate the bone marrow and disrupt red blood cell production.
    • Myelodysplastic Syndromes (MDS): A group of disorders where the bone marrow doesn’t produce enough healthy blood cells.
  • Chronic Diseases: Many chronic illnesses can interfere with red blood cell production or lifespan:
    • Kidney Disease: Damaged kidneys produce less erythropoietin (EPO), a hormone that stimulates red blood cell production.
    • Inflammatory Conditions: Diseases like rheumatoid arthritis, lupus, and Crohn’s disease can cause anemia of chronic disease by affecting iron metabolism and the body’s response to EPO.
    • Infections: Certain chronic infections can suppress bone marrow function.
    • Cancer: Beyond cancers directly affecting the bone marrow, other cancers can lead to anemia through various mechanisms, including inflammation and nutrient depletion.
  • Endocrine Disorders: Conditions like hypothyroidism can sometimes be associated with anemia.

Increased Red Blood Cell Destruction (Hemolytic Anemias): The Premature Demise

In these types of anemia, red blood cells are destroyed faster than the bone marrow can produce them.

  • Inherited Conditions:
    • Sickle Cell Anemia: A genetic disorder where red blood cells are abnormally shaped and easily destroyed.
    • Thalassemia: A group of genetic disorders characterized by reduced production of hemoglobin.
    • Hereditary Spherocytosis: A condition where red blood cells have an abnormal shape and are prone to destruction.
  • Acquired Conditions:
    • Autoimmune Hemolytic Anemia: The immune system mistakenly attacks and destroys red blood cells.
    • Infections: Certain infections, like malaria, can directly destroy red blood cells.
    • Certain Medications: Some drugs can trigger a hemolytic reaction.
    • Mechanical Damage: Artificial heart valves or other medical devices can sometimes damage red blood cells.

Blood Loss: The Leaky System

Significant or chronic blood loss can deplete the body’s red blood cell supply, leading to low hemoglobin.

  • Gastrointestinal Bleeding: Ulcers, polyps, inflammatory bowel disease, and cancers in the digestive tract can cause slow, chronic blood loss that may not be immediately apparent.
  • Menstrual Bleeding: Heavy or prolonged menstrual periods are a common cause of iron deficiency anemia in women.
  • Trauma or Surgery: Acute blood loss from injuries or surgical procedures can lead to a sudden drop in hemoglobin.
  • Frequent Blood Donation: While beneficial for some, very frequent blood donation without adequate iron replenishment can lead to low hemoglobin.
  • Urinary Tract Bleeding: Less common, but bleeding in the urinary tract can also contribute to blood loss.

The Diagnostic Journey: Pinpointing the Problem

The first step to managing low hemoglobin is a proper diagnosis by a healthcare professional. This typically involves:

  • Medical History and Physical Examination: Your doctor will ask about your symptoms, diet, medications, family history, and lifestyle. They will also perform a physical exam, looking for signs like pale skin or an enlarged spleen.
  • Complete Blood Count (CBC): This common blood test measures various components of your blood, including hemoglobin, red blood cell count, and hematocrit (the proportion of red blood cells in your blood).
  • Other Blood Tests: Depending on the suspected cause, further blood tests may be ordered to:
    • Check iron levels (ferritin, serum iron, total iron-binding capacity).
    • Assess vitamin B12 and folate levels.
    • Evaluate for signs of inflammation or kidney function.
    • Test for specific antibodies or genetic markers if a hemolytic anemia is suspected.
  • Bone Marrow Biopsy: In some complex cases, a bone marrow biopsy might be necessary to assess the bone marrow’s ability to produce blood cells.

Treatment Strategies: Restoring the Balance

Treatment for low hemoglobin is highly dependent on the underlying cause.

  • Dietary Changes and Supplements:
    • Iron Supplements: For iron-deficiency anemia, iron supplements are usually prescribed. It’s crucial to take them as directed by your doctor, as too much iron can be harmful. Dietary sources rich in iron, such as red meat, poultry, fish, beans, and leafy green vegetables, should also be incorporated.
    • Vitamin B12 and Folate Supplements: If a deficiency in these vitamins is identified, supplements and dietary adjustments (e.g., fortified foods, dairy, meat for B12; leafy greens, citrus fruits for folate) will be recommended.
  • Addressing Underlying Conditions: If low hemoglobin is caused by a chronic disease, infection, or bleeding disorder, treating that primary condition is essential. This might involve medications, surgery, or lifestyle modifications.
  • Blood Transfusions: In cases of severe anemia or rapid blood loss, a blood transfusion may be necessary to quickly replenish red blood cell levels.
  • Medications to Stimulate Red Blood Cell Production: For anemia related to kidney disease, synthetic erythropoietin (EPO) injections may be prescribed.
